RE: Question...
There is a clear plastic film over the body to protect the outside from over spray. after you paint but before you put the decals on, you can remove it. after you trim it, you will see around the edge where it is starting to come up. it just peals off. I did it last night with my el camino

RE: Question...
It's a super thin sheet of clear sticker that goes over the entire body on the outside. It's hard to tell that it's there because you really can't see it (it's clear). Before you put any decals on, you need to remove this. Take an exacto knife and try to peel it off at the corner of the wheel well.
Once you get just a piece of it up, it'll be alot easier to peel it off. Use the force, Luke.
